Baixe o app para aproveitar ainda mais
Prévia do material em texto
Pergunta 1 1 em 1 pontos Para declarar uma matriz 3 X 3 de elementos literais, qual seria o comando adequado? Resposta Selecionada: e. m : vetor [1..3,1..3] de literal Respostas: a. m : matriz [1..3, 1..3] de literal b. m : vetor =[1,2,3; 1,2,3] de literal c. m : matriz [1..9] de literal d. m : matriz [1..3, 1..3] de literal e. m : vetor [1..3,1..3] de literal Pergunta 2 1 em 1 pontos Trabalhando com matrizes, costumamos usar duas variáveis para a contagem, ou seja, I e J. Por qual motivo é necessário? Resposta Selecionada: d. Porque as matrizes têm 2 dimensões: linha e coluna. Respostas: a. Porque se não usar 2 variáveis não é possível carregar elementos de uma matriz. b. Para carregar as matrizes ao contrário. c. Só é necessário se não for ler do teclado. d. Porque as matrizes têm 2 dimensões: linha e coluna. e. Não é necessário, basta usar uma delas. Pergunta 3 0 em 1 pontos Com o código abaixo, o que se consegue obter com a variável y ? se x[i,j] > y então y := x[i,j] fimse Resposta Selecionada: c. O menor valor de x[i,j] Respostas: a. A contagem dos números onde y = x[i,j] b. A soma dos elementos da matriz c. O menor valor de x[i,j] d. A média dos elementos da matriz e. O maior valor de x[i,j] Pergunta 4 1 em 1 pontos O que o algoritmo abaixo faz? Para i:=1 ate 4 faca Para j:=1 ate 4 faca Escreval(“informe numero da linha ”, i , “ coluna “, j) Leia(numero[i,j]) numero[i,i] : =10 Fimpara Fimpara fimalgoritmo Resposta Selecionada: e. Lê os números de uma matriz 4 X 4 via teclado e torna os da diagonal principal iguais a 10 Respostas: a. Lê os números de uma matriz 4 X 4 via teclado e zera esses números b. Lê os números de uma matriz 4 X 4 via teclado c. Lê os números de uma matriz 4 X 4 via teclado e torna os da diagonal secundária iguais a 10 d. Lê os números de uma matriz 4 X 4 via teclado e torna todos eles iguais a 10 e. Lê os números de uma matriz 4 X 4 via teclado e torna os da diagonal principal iguais a 10 Pergunta 5 1 em 1 pontos O que o algoritmo abaixo faz? ALGORITMO “QUESTAO6” VAR I , J : inteiro numero :vetor[1..3,1..3] de inteiro Inicio Para i:=3 ate 1 passo -1 faca Para j:= 1 ate 3 faca Escreval(“informe numero da linha ”, i , “ coluna “, j) leia(numero[i,j]) Fimpara Fimpara Resposta Selecionada: b. Carrega a matriz em ordem decrescente de linha e crescente de coluna. Respostas: a. Carrega a matriz em ordem crescente de linha e decrescente de coluna. b. Carrega a matriz em ordem decrescente de linha e crescente de coluna. c. Carrega a matriz em ordem crescente de linha e coluna. d. Carrega a matriz em ordem decrescente de linha e coluna. e. Carrega a matriz em ordem aleatória. Pergunta 6 1 em 1 pontos O comando do tipo “soma : = soma + numero[i,j]’ serve para: Resposta Selecionada: b. Somar todos os valores de uma matriz. Respostas: a. Somar os valores de uma linha de uma matriz. b. Somar todos os valores de uma matriz. c. Contar todos os valores de uma matriz. d. Somar os valores de uma coluna de uma matriz. e. Somar os elementos da diagonal secundária de uma matriz. Pergunta 7 1 em 1 pontos O que o algoritmo abaixo faz ? Para i:=1 ate 3 faca Para j:=1 ate 3 faca Escreval(“informe numero da linha ”, i , “ coluna “, j) Leia(numero[i,j]) numero[i,i] : =5 Fimpara Fimpara Resposta Selecionada: d. Lê os números de uma matriz 3 X 3 via teclado e torna os da diagonal principal iguais a 5. Respostas: a. Lê os números de uma matriz 3 X 3 via teclado e torna todos eles iguais a 5. b. Lê os números de uma matriz 3 X 3 via teclado. c. Lê os números de uma matriz 3 X 3 via teclado e zera esses números. d. Lê os números de uma matriz 3 X 3 via teclado e torna os da diagonal principal iguais a 5. e. Lê os números de uma matriz 3 X 3 via teclado e torna os da diagonal secundária iguais a 5. Pergunta 8 0 em 1 pontos Quanto às matrizes do visualg, podemos dizer que: Resposta Selecionada: c. São unidimensionais. Respostas: a. Devem ter dados de mesmo tipo. b. Podem ter dados de tipos diferentes. c. São unidimensionais. d. Só podem ser quadradas, ou seja, o número de linhas é igual ao número de colunas. e. Podem ter linhas com dimensões diferentes. Pergunta 9 1 em 1 pontos Para declarar uma matriz 9 X 9 de elementos de texto, qual seria o comando adequado? Resposta Selecionada: e. m: vetor [1..9,1..9] de literal Respostas: a. m : matriz [1..81] de literal b. m : vetor =[1 até 9; 1 até 9] de literal c. m: vetor [1..9,1..9] de inteiro d. m : matriz [1..9, 1..9] de literal e. m: vetor [1..9,1..9] de literal Pergunta 10 0 em 1 pontos Nos exemplos que vimos, quando utilizamos matrizes no Visualg, costumamos usar duas variáveis, I e J, em duas estruturas de repetição do tipo “PARA”. Por qual motivo precisamos fazer assim? Resposta Selecionada: c. Porque se não usar 2 variáveis, não é possível carregar elementos de uma matriz Respostas: a. Só é necessário se não for ler do teclado b. Isso é opcional em qualquer caso c. Porque se não usar 2 variáveis, não é possível carregar elementos de uma matriz d. Porque as matrizes têm 2 dimensões: linha e coluna e. Por redundância - não é necessário ter 2 variáveis, basta usar uma delas
Compartilhar